Expectations for Design and Artwork Submission
One of the most significant aspects to expect from thestudio.com is comprehensive design assistance, which sets it apart from many other custom product providers that require ready-to-print files.
- No Prior Design Experience Needed: You should expect that you don’t need to be a graphic design expert. The platform openly states they offer “free, professional design support.” This means you can come with a rough sketch, a detailed idea, or even just a concept, and their team will help translate it into a tangible design.
- Iterative Design Process: Anticipate an “infinite revisions” policy. This implies that the design phase will be iterative. You’ll likely receive initial mockups, provide feedback, and they’ll make adjustments until the design perfectly matches your expectations. This process minimizes the risk of dissatisfaction with the final product.
- Versatile Artwork Handling: Whether you have print-ready files or just an idea, the platform is equipped to handle it. They specifically mention uploading “ready-made files directly” or using their “integral AI tool” to assist in creation, which their professional designers will then refine. This flexibility is a major convenience.

- Extensive Customization Options: Expect a wide array of options to tailor your merchandise. This includes choices for materials, colors, finishes, and specific manufacturing techniques relevant to your chosen product (e.g., embroidery types for hats, various patch backings). Their promise of “the widest array of manufacturing choices” suggests a deep catalog of possibilities.
- Mockup and Sample Approval: Crucially, anticipate receiving a “mockup and physical sample for your review” before mass production begins. This step is a cornerstone of their quality control and customer satisfaction guarantee. It means you can physically inspect the product and ensure every detail is correct before committing to the full order. This proactive approach helps prevent costly errors down the line.
- High-Quality Output: The repeated emphasis on “Unmatched Quality” and products “Crafted by Our Trusted Partners” suggests a commitment to durable and aesthetically pleasing results. While personal experience can vary, the stated goal is to provide premium customizable products.
Expectations Regarding Process Transparency and Support
The platform is designed to be transparent about its process and readily available for support.
- Clear Step-by-Step Guidance: The “Effortless Customization Process” described in four steps provides a clear roadmap from concept to delivery. You can expect to understand where you are in the production pipeline at any given moment.
- Accessible Customer Service: Expect easy access to assistance. With a phone number, email address, and a chat option prominently displayed, you can anticipate responsive support for any questions or issues that arise during your project. This is vital for complex custom orders where clarity and communication are key.
- Timely Delivery: While specific timelines for individual products are not front-and-center, the promise of “Swift Turnaround” and delivery “within the agreed timeframe” indicates a commitment to efficiency. You should expect that delivery schedules will be communicated clearly once an order is confirmed.
- Satisfaction Guarantee: The “100% satisfaction guarantee” means that if there are issues with the final product that don’t meet the agreed-upon specifications or quality, you have recourse. This policy provides peace of mind, though the specifics of returns and refunds would be detailed in their Terms & Conditions.
What Not to Expect (or What Might Require Further Inquiry)
While generally comprehensive, there are a few things not to immediately expect from the homepage.
- Instant Pricing: Don’t expect to see immediate, precise pricing for every item without initiating a project. Custom manufacturing costs vary significantly based on quantity, complexity, and materials, so a personalized quote will be necessary.
- Deep Dive into Partner Factories: While they mention “trusted partners,” don’t expect a detailed list or certifications for each specific factory upfront. This information might be available upon deeper inquiry or for larger, ongoing projects.
